I ordered the three rolls that did not contain either shrimp or crab, which seemed to be 95% of the offerings. I ordered spicy tuna, spicy salmon, and salmon. My wife ordered the Chirashi Don.
The fish was fresh. The rolls were pretty good – nothing special, but I wouldn’t complain eating them again. My wife enjoyed the Chirashi Don saying that the addition of the crunchy crab was nice, but it could have been served warm.
Service was barely adequate. Having not been provided napkins, we asked another server for some and his surliness foreshadowed that he wasn’t going to bring any. With our server pulling the “disappearing waiter” routine, we finally asked one of the busboys for napkins and got some. We didn’t see our waiter until he came by at the end and we requested the bill.

The food is served in the traditional courses: soup, salad, rice, meats and finally your veggies. I have included shots of each course as they arrived from my steak and scallop order, including a few shots of the artistry that goes into cooking the food while you watch.
I cannot compliment the food here enough. I have been eating here for years and they have some of the freshest sushi (ranging from $5-15/roll), excellent main dishes and some of the best fried rice i have had. However, what makes this restaurant stand out is their level of service. We encountered some of the most polite staff that I have ever seen. Our main server was Ryan, and every answer was either, “Yes, sir.”, “Right away, sir.”, or “My pleasure, sir.” Drinks were refilled before we even knew they were low and at every course change he asked how it was and if we required anything else when he cleared the table for the next round. Other servers, who did not currently have a table would also check on our status while Ryan was tending to our orders. One young woman even mistook my son because of his long hair and referred to him as ‘madame’. When she left, he turned to me and said, “You know, I am not even slightly offended by that since she was so polite about it. Hard to get upset when she’s that nice.”
Over all the experience was great. Excellent food, good conversation with our table and wonderful service. It was the perfect way to cap off a long week of work and it is something I am looking forward to doing again soon.
